Transaction 296006fc083050248d24b937276d7b129dded433541f52975e1b1f9c5938468e
1 Input
1 Output
-
296006fc083050248d24b937276d7b129dded433541f52975e1b1f9c5938468e:0
- value
- 154655
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2e2c355d2e9a32a97b1ac172f963dfee950a98f
- address
- bc1qut3vx4wjax3j49a34stjl93alm54p2v0243vjs